What radio station are the chicago bears on? Radio: WBBM AM-780, FM-105.9 (Jeff Joniak, Tom Thayer, Mark Grote). National Radio: Westwood One (Ryan Radtke, Tony Boselli).
What radio station can I listen to the Chicago Bears on? Listen to every Bears game live with Jeff Joniak (play-by-play), former Bears guard Tom Thayer (analyst) and Mark Grote (sideline reporter). Note: On mobile devices, NFL rules limit this content to fans in the Chicago area only.

What is the impact of the radio act of 1927?
The act created the Federal Radio Commission (FRC), which was primarily directed to license broadcasters and reduce radio interference, a benefit to both broadcasters and the public in the chaos that developed in the aftermath of the breakdown of earlier wireless radio acts.

Can cb and ham radio communicate?
CB radios are not capable of operating on authorized amateur radio frequencies and “ham” amatuer radio operators are prohibited from transmitting on the CB frequencies except in an emergency where no other method of communication is available.

Which vhf marine radio channel is reserved for distress calls?
Channel 16 (156.8 MHz) VHF-FM is designated by the FCC (Federal Communications Commission) as the national distress, safety and calling frequency. All vessels must monitor this channel while underway.

How do they build giant radio towers?
A large fixed boom crane the is used to erect the tower up to or above the first set of guy wires which are attached to guy anchors. Then the tower is rigged with two cables , load and gin pole jump through a gin pole that is now used to erect the tower one section at a time.
